Olivia Hussey was born on April 17, 1951, in Buenos Aires, Argentina. She was raised in her early years in Argentina before moving with her family to London when she was just seven years old. As a child, she showed a natural talent for acting, and her parents encouraged her to pursue her passion for the arts.
After moving to London, Olivia attended the Italia Conti Academy drama school, where she honed her acting skills and learned the craft of performing. It was during her time at Italia Conti that she discovered her love for acting and decided to pursue a career in the entertainment industry.
Olivia's big break came when she was cast as Juliet in Franco Zeffirelli's 1968 film adaptation of Romeo and Juliet. The film was a huge success and catapulted Olivia to stardom. Her performance in the film was praised for its emotional depth and authenticity, earning her critical acclaim and establishing her as a rising star in Hollywood.
After gaining fame as Juliet, Olivia went on to star in several horror films, showcasing her versatility as an actress. She appeared in movies such as Virus and Death on The Nile, where she demonstrated her ability to tackle different genres and roles with ease.
